Notes
- The Chadirji mentioned in the title is Kamil bin Rifaat Al-Jadirji (Baghdad 1315-1388 AH = 1897-1968 AD). Al-Rusafi mentioned in the title is Marouf Abdul-Ghani Al-Rusafi (Baghdad 1294 - 1394 AH = 1873 - 1945 AD). - The message includes seven hadiths, detailed as follows: From (pp. 4-28) 1- Hadith of July 28, 1944 (pp. 4-9) 2- Hadith of August 5, 1944 (pp. 9-12) 3- Hadith of August 11, 1944 (pp. 13-19) 4- Hadith on August 25, 1944 (pp. 19-20) 5- Hadith on September 8, 1944 (pp. 20-23) 6- Hadith on September 24, 1944 (pp. 24-27) 7- Hadith On September 29, 1944 (pp. 27-28) - These seven hadiths, published by: Dr. Youssef Ezz Al-Din in his book (Iraqi Poets in the Twentieth Century), (1: 56 - 51, 62 - 64, 64 - 70, 70 - 71, 71 - 74, 74 - 77, 78 - 79). This is followed by: Appendix: 1- The editorial written by the newspaper (Sawt al-Ahali): (No. 822, March 18, 1945), in which I touched on Al-Rusafi’s lineage: (pp. 30-35). 2- The article written by the late Taha Al-Rawi in (Alam Al-Ghad) magazine: (Ninth Issue - First Year - Baghdad, April 1, 1945), in which he researched Al-Rusafi’s lineage: pp. 36-42). 3- A letter addressed by the owner of the newspaper (Sawt Al-Ahali): (Issue 836, April 3, 1945) to the late Taha Al-Rawi, regarding what he wrote in (Alam Al-Ghad) magazine: (pp. 43-44). 4- Al-Rusafi between Professor Taha Al-Rawi and the owner of the newspaper (Sawt Al-Ahali): (Sawt Al-Ahali, Issue No. 846, April 16, 1945): (pp. 45-54). A letter dated July 25, 1951, sent by Kamel Al-Chadirji to Dr. Jawad Ali (Secretary of the Iraqi Scientific Academy - Baghdad), in which it said: Dear Dr. Jawad Ali: “Based on your desire, I present to you a copy that matches the original of the hadiths that I had written down during separate sessions he held with the great poet, the late Marouf Al-Rusafi, in the summer of 1944, and they - as you will see, when you look closely at them - need coordination and some explanations.” And the comments before they were published. I had made it clear to you that I am still not convinced that publishing them, as they are, will be acceptable, but at the same time I am certain that it is not permissible for them to remain neglected or withheld, given the information they contain that may be unique in their context...” A handwritten copy, written by Kamel Chadirji with his own pen, in a large, lined notebook.
